Are funds’ corn views heading for the ultra-bearish year-ago levels?

NAPERVILLE, Illinois, June 23 (Reuters) – Like a broken record, speculators continued selling Chicago corn last week. Their bearish corn stance is now almost identical to their year-ago one, which preceded the all-time net short set in early July. There are some notable differences between the two years, however.
